This is probably a stupid question, but i have a 2001 honda accord coupe with the vtec v6, i wanted to know if it was possible to swap the automatic tranmission with a manual. If it is possible, what modifications would i have to make? including the interior.... like the shifter and center console.|||Honestly you can almost buy a manual for the cost of the conversion. The parts needed are: tranny, tranny mounts, ECU from the manual car, COMPLETE wiring harness from the manual car, hydraulic lines, clutch master cylinder, shift linkages, flywheel from the manual car, clutch assembly, the three pedal assembly because the brake in the automatic doesn't allow proper spacing for the clutch, shifter, shift boot, shift knob, center console for the manual, and various little odds and ends. After all is said and done you can expect about $5,000-$8,000 for the NEW parts and labor to get it done CORRECTLY AND SAFE.|||It's been done many times. You'll need a clutch pedal w brackets, a master cylinder w line and push rod, you will also need a slave cylinder.
you need a clutch, pressure plate, throw out bearing. with the correct manual transmission..
you'll need a shifter w brackets. You may have to see if the axle for the auto will work with the manual tyranny. oh you'll also need a new flywheel
